Understanding Twin Births: The Basics
Twins have fascinated humans for centuries. But how often do twins actually occur? The answer lies in the biology behind twin pregnancies, which can be broadly categorized into two types: identical (monozygotic) and fraternal (dizygotic) twins.
Identical twins happen when a single fertilized egg splits into two embryos. This type of twinning occurs randomly and is relatively consistent worldwide, affecting roughly 3 to 4 per 1,000 births. On the other hand, fraternal twins result from two separate eggs fertilized by two different sperm cells during one pregnancy. This type is influenced by genetics, maternal age, and other factors, causing more variation across populations.
Overall, twin births make up about 1.2% of all births globally. However, this number can soar or dip depending on where you live and your family history. Understanding these nuances is key to answering the question: How common is having twins?
Geographical Variation in Twin Birth Rates
Twin birth rates are far from uniform across the globe. Some regions experience a much higher frequency of twins than others due to genetic backgrounds and environmental factors.
In West Africa, particularly Nigeria and Benin, twinning rates are among the highest in the world—approximately 18 to 20 per 1,000 births. This high rate mainly reflects fraternal twinning influenced by hereditary predispositions and dietary factors.
Conversely, East Asian countries like Japan and China report some of the lowest twinning rates globally, averaging around 6 per 1,000 births. Europe and North America fall somewhere in between but have seen rising rates over recent decades due to fertility treatments.
These differences highlight how complex the factors behind twin births are—it’s not just chance but a mix of biology, culture, and technology shaping those numbers.

The Role of Genetics in How Common Is Having Twins?
Genetics plays a starring role in determining whether twins will arrive. If a woman has a family history of fraternal twins on her mother’s side, her chances of conceiving twins increase significantly. This is because hyperovulation—the release of multiple eggs during ovulation—tends to run in families.
Interestingly, while women can inherit this tendency to release more than one egg at a time, men can pass on this trait even if they themselves were not born as twins. So if your mother or grandmother had fraternal twins, your odds go up.
However, identical twinning doesn’t seem linked to heredity; it’s mostly a random event during early embryo development with no known genetic influence.

The Impact of Maternal Age and Fertility Treatments on Twin Rates
Maternal age is another big player in twin pregnancies. Women over 35 tend to have higher levels of follicle-stimulating hormone (FSH), which can lead to releasing multiple eggs during ovulation. This naturally bumps up the chance of fraternal twins.
But what really changed the game over recent decades is assisted reproductive technology (ART). Treatments like in vitro fertilization (IVF) often involve implanting multiple embryos or stimulating ovaries to produce more eggs at once. This has caused twin birth rates to spike dramatically in countries where these technologies are widely used.
In fact, many developed countries saw their twin birth rates climb by as much as 70% between the 1980s and early 2000s due to fertility treatments alone.
Still, medical professionals now aim for single embryo transfers during IVF cycles to reduce risks associated with multiple pregnancies while maintaining high success rates.

The Science Behind Identical vs Fraternal Twins: Why Does It Matter?
Knowing whether twins are identical or fraternal isn’t just trivia—it has real implications for health risks and family dynamics.
Identical twins share nearly all their DNA since they come from one fertilized egg that splits early on. They’re always the same sex and look strikingly alike. However, they’re at slightly higher risk for complications such as twin-to-twin transfusion syndrome when sharing a placenta.
Fraternal twins develop from two separate eggs fertilized independently. They share about half their genes—like regular siblings—and can be different sexes or look nothing alike. Their health risks generally mirror those of singleton pregnancies but with added concerns due to carrying multiples.
Doctors use ultrasounds and sometimes genetic testing after birth to classify twin types accurately because it guides prenatal care strategies tailored for each set’s unique needs.

The Health Implications of Twin Pregnancies for Mothers and Babies
Twin pregnancies carry unique challenges compared with singleton ones—both for moms-to-be and their babies.
Mothers expecting twins face increased risks including:
- Preeclampsia—a dangerous rise in blood pressure during pregnancy;
- Anemia;
- C-section delivery;
- Ectopic pregnancy risk;
- Larger physical strain due to carrying multiples;
Babies born as part of twin sets also tend toward lower birth weights and earlier deliveries—preterm birth being significantly more common than with singletons. These factors raise concerns about neonatal intensive care needs immediately after birth.
Despite these risks though:
- A majority of twin pregnancies result in healthy babies when managed carefully through regular prenatal monitoring.
Modern obstetric care focuses heavily on minimizing complications through early detection using ultrasounds and tailored interventions such as bed rest or medications when needed.
